What is Window Condensation?
Window condensation occurs when water vapor in the air enters contact with a cooler surface, such as glass. The air can hold just a specific amount of moisture at an offered temperature; when it cools, the vapor becomes liquid water, looking like droplets on the window.

Comprehending the causes of window condensation can assist homeowners deal with the scenario efficiently. The main elements include:
1. Humidity Levels
Indoor humidity levels are generally greater throughout the winter season due to heating. Sources of moisture can include:
CookingShoweringHouseplantsDrying clothing indoors2. Temperature Difference
The considerable distinction in between indoor and outside temperature levels adds to condensation. When warm, humid air fulfills the cooler window surface, condensation occurs.
3. Insufficient Ventilation
Poor ventilation avoids moist air from getting away, resulting in raised levels of humidity. Areas like bathroom and kitchens require correct airflow.
4. Window Quality
Older windows or those with a broken seal are more susceptible to condensation. Modern Double Glazing Fog or triple-glazed windows are more effective in avoiding this problem due to their insulation homes.

Yes, some level of condensation is regular, particularly during temperature level changes. Nevertheless, consistent condensation might suggest underlying problems that need resolving.
Q2: Can condensation on windows damage my home?
Yes, excessive condensation can result in mold development and damage to window frames and walls. It is important to manage humidity and ventilation to decrease these risks.
Q3: How can I prevent window condensation?
To avoid condensation, control indoor humidity levels, make sure appropriate ventilation, upgrade to energy-efficient windows, and preserve a consistent indoor temperature.
Q4: Is condensation on the exterior of windows a problem?
Condensation on the exterior of windows is typically less worrying than that on the inside and is often an indication of temperature level guideline. However, if it causes water pooling, it might need attention.
